The Archbishop of Fortaleza ordains three deacons of the Shalom Community at the Church of the Risen 1o1z1c

Missionaries from the Community of Life — Adson Zanuzo, Isaac Soares, and Rafael César — received the diaconate on May 17th, marking the first diaconal ordination held at the Church of the Risen located in the Diaconia (Aquiraz, Brazil). 5l6861

On May 17th, three missionaries from the Catholic Shalom Community were ordained transitional deacons through the laying on of hands and the consecration prayer by Dom Gregório Paixão, OSB, Archbishop of Fortaleza (CE). This was the first sacrament of orders celebrated at the Church of the Risen Who ed Through the Cross.

Adson Zanuzo, Isaac Soares, and Rafael César were consecrated to the first degree of the sacrament of orders, publicly assuming the commitment to serve God and the Church in the diaconal ministry.

“A service born from love” 726k5d

During the homily, Dom Gregório reflected on John 13:31-33a, 34-35 and addressed words of exhortation to the new deacons, emphasizing the call to deep love for God, the Church, and the Shalom charism:

“Be men of prayer. To serve — and serve joyfully — intimacy with Love is necessary. To rise each day, with the grace of dawn, and begin again, it is only possible if we are recharged by the power of love.”

The archbishop also highlighted that the diaconal ministry, before being a burden, is a continuous service sustained by love:

“Do not forget something fundamental when exercising this service. Yes, it is a responsibility, but above all, it is a service born of love: love for God, love for brothers and sisters — that is the great commandment. Love for the holy Church, left by Our Lord Jesus Christ, and also love for the place where you have chosen to carry out God’s plan. The place you can never stop loving is where God has placed you: the Catholic Shalom Community.”

A milestone in Church history 496o24

At the end of the celebration, Moysés Azevedo, founder and general of the Shalom Community, thanked Dom Gregório for allowing this diaconal ordination to take place at the Church of the Risen:

“It is very beautiful to witness these ordinations here, as a confirmation of this vocation that the Community and the Church have. These deacons, later priests, will go out into the whole world serving the Church through the strength of the charism,” Moysés stated.
